摘要
对城市轨道交通钢轨电位限制器应用中存在的问题进行分析,如频繁通断及闭锁会导致杂散电流泄露增大、运营维护工作量增加等。结合钢轨电位限制器的功能及动作原理,提出引入列车进/出站信号作为保护判据的新型控制方式,以减少钢轨电位限制器的误动作。
Existing problems in the application of negative potential monitoring and protection devices in urban rail transit are examined. For example, frequent opening/closing the device caused the increase of stray current leakage and maintenance work load. Based on the functions and principles of the device, the paper puts forward the new control method which takes the entry/exit signal of trains as one of the protection criteria so as to decrease the fauky action of the device.
